Tim Cook announces "record weekend" of iPad sales
Gene Munster knew that today's analyst conference call was reserved for discussion of Apple's newly announced dividend and stock repurchase plans, but he couldn't help himself -- he tried to sneak in a question about current results, specifically whether Apple would be issuing a press release about this weekend's iPad launch.
Tim Cook, naturally, was prepared for this impudence, and promptly released a squadron of nanodrones to shock Munster into submission carefully guarded his answer. "We had a record weekend and we're thrilled," he said, but declined to provide any specific numbers at this time.
iPad presales and in-person lines were reported as hefty around the world, but we'll have to wait a little longer to get an exact measure of how successful the Retina-equipped device launch really was.
